I have been able to get the OpenVPN client to work on a ubuntu machine with our VPN server and 2FA. The VPN server uses user-auth-pass. Once the username/password are verified it sends a prompt for the user to enter the 2FA code.

With WTWare I am getting an error that says "neither stdin nor stderr are a tty device and you have neither a controlling tty nor systemd - can't ask for 'CHALLENGE: <MESSAGE>...." Exiting due to fatal error.

I am able to get the VPN to connect without 2FA, but I need to get it to work with 2FA.
